Ingredients of Banana chocolate chip cookies

  1. Prepare 1/2 cup of sugar.
  2. It’s 1/2 cup of softened butter.
  3. It’s 1 of eggs.
  4. You need 2 of bananas mashed.
  5. You need 1 tsp of vanilla extract.
  6. Prepare 1 cup of all-purpose flour.
  7. Prepare 1 tbsp of baking powder.
  8. You need 1/4 tsp of salt.
  9. Prepare 1 tbsp of baking soda.
  10. You need 1 cup of chocolate chips.
  11. Prepare 1 cup of filberts nuts (optional).

Banana chocolate chip cookies instructions

  1. Mix the butter and sugar until it light and fluffy. Then beat in the eggs, bananas and vanilla. Combine the flour, baking powder,salt and baking soda. Add to creamed mixture and mix well adding chocolate chips and nuts.
  2. Drop by tablespoons 2 in apart on cookie sheet bake at 350° for 10-12 minutes or tell edge are light brown.
